You can change the width of the template by changing 3 widths in the css and preferably one image needs to be rescaled to the desired width - in the scheme of customization this hardly a big deal. You will only do this if you don't want to scroll a bit horizontally on a small screen.

Here they are

#header {
width: Xpx;
margin: 0 auto 10px auto;
height: 100px;
}

.page {
width: Xpx;
margin: 0 auto 10px auto;
text-align: left;
clear: both;
}

.col_left_content {
float: left;
width: Ypx;
position: relative;
left: 20px;
}

Image to rescale = layout_shape.gif

if you wish to narrow the columns then you can do that too. Two numbers to change. You can even delete a column if you wish but then you will not be able to use templatezones. That is not what this thread is about. So back to the plot.

If I put an image in which does not take account of the container it sits in and the related images like the tabs in that container then it is not going to do what you want it to. Spend some time looking at the code and adjusting things - see what the css code does when you change a number - it is not blogger. Change a value and then refresh.

In the css and even in the instructions.txt it says logo set for 80px height and width upto 320px . How much clearer can we make it.

#logo {
background: url(../../../images/logo.gif) no-repeat;
height: 80px;
width: 320px;
float: left;
margin: 10px 0 10px 15px;
padding: 0;
color: #fff;
text-align: left;
}
